JUDD: Kathleen Alice. Peacefully on January 5, 2009, Kathleen passed away at Misericordia Health Centre at the age of 93. Kathleen is survived by three daughters Sharon (Clarence) Kitson of Flin Flon, Manitoba, Jill (Peter) Dixon of St. Albert, Alberta Marsha (Dave) Greenhow of Winnipeg, MB; ten grandchildren; 11 great grandchildren; three sisters-in-law; numerous n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by her husband Jim in 2004; parents and all siblings. Kathleen was born in Portage la Prairie on July 14, 1915 and moved to Flin Flon in 1939 to marry Dad. They resided there until they retired to Brandon in 1974. After Dads passing in 2004, Mom moved to elderly personal housing at Donwood Manor and resided there until breaking a hip in September 2008. Mom spent the last month on Crocus 2 at Misericordia Interim Care Centre. Mom enjoyed knitting, petite point, crocheting doing crosswords, bingo and reading. She was a member of the North Minister United Church in Flin Flon and also the Central United Church in Brandon. While in Flin Flon she worked as a stenographer at Flin Flon General Hospital. In Brandon she enjoyed volunteering her time at Fairview Home. Family was important to Mom and she always looked forward to visits from her children and grandchildren. The Memorial Service will be held at the Brockie Donovan Chapel, 332-8th Street, on Tuesday, July 14, 2009 at 11:00 a.m. with Rev. Laird Russell-Yearwood of Central United Church officiating. Interment will take place at the Brandon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in Kathleens memory to the Heart and Stroke Foundation of Manitoba.
